The Aviators soared to a commanding victory over the River Cats, winning 9-2. Turner Hill led the charge with a homer and two RBIs, fueling a strong offensive showing. With 13 hits and a solid pitching performance, the Aviators showcased their dominance throughout the game.
The Aviators took control early and never looked back, scoring nine runs on 13 hits against the River Cats. Turner Hill was a standout, going 2-for-4 with a home run and two RBIs, setting the tone for the offense.
Las Vegas capitalized on their chances, drawing seven walks while Sacramento struggled to convert, leaving five runners stranded. The pitching from Luis Morales, who allowed just one earned run in five innings, was instrumental in keeping the River Cats at bay.
The Aviators are winners of 3 straight, 7-3 over their last 10. The River Cats are winners of 2 straight, 7-3 over their last 10.
